Hospitality Europe General Meeting

On Monday, 14 November, the Hospitality Europe Association, which oversees the work of the European office of the Hospitaller Order in Brussels, convened its second general meeting in 2016.

The new member of the Association, Brother Joachim Mačejovský, the Superior of the Austrian Province, attended the general meeting for the first time and was warmly welcomed by Brother Rudolf Knopp, President of Hospitality Europe.

Dr Galasso spoke about the most recent work of the European office and illustrated the progress made with the DESkTOP project (for centres for people with disabilities), the pilot project on violence in psychiatric patients, and the candidature for EU funding for the Order’s Vocational Schools Congress (Granada, April 2017). 16 new projects had been selected and their implementation would begin in the Provinces during 2017.

The meeting also analysed the present and future situation of the Order and the Congregation of the Sisters Hospitallers in the United Kingdom, which will have to deal with the uncertainties of Brexit and doubts regarding future participation in European programmes.

The dates of next year’s general meetings will be 13 March and 30 October.
